Unlocking the Nuances of Microphone Technology in 2024
As the landscape of audio technology continues to evolve, understanding the subtle differences between microphone types becomes crucial for content creators aiming for professional quality. In 2024, advancements in capsule design, digital signal processing, and connectivity have expanded the options available, making it essential to grasp what truly makes a microphone stand out. For instance, condenser microphones with gold-sputtered capsules now offer increased sensitivity and clarity, ideal for capturing nuanced vocal tones in studio environments. Conversely, dynamic microphones excel in handling high sound pressure levels, making them perfect for energetic live streaming or podcasting sessions where background noise is a concern.
How Do Microphone Polar Patterns Influence Your Recording Quality?
One of the often-overlooked aspects of microphone selection is the polar pattern, which determines how a microphone picks up sound from different directions. In my experience, cardioid microphones are a staple for podcasting because they focus on the speaker’s voice while rejecting ambient noise. However, in more complex setups, such as multi-host podcasts or interviews, omnidirectional or figure-eight patterns can facilitate a more natural sound environment, capturing multiple voices without significant bleed. The key is understanding your environment and choosing a pattern that aligns with your recording space and goals.

What Should You Consider When Integrating Microphones into a Multi-Source Setup?
Integrating multiple microphones—say, for a panel or group discussion—requires careful planning. Phase alignment, gain staging, and background noise management become more complex as more sources are added. Using directional microphones with tight pickup patterns can help minimize crosstalk, while an audio interface with multiple channels ensures each voice is captured distinctly. Additionally, employing headphone monitoring allows for real-time quality checks, preventing issues before they reach your audience. Can High-Resolution Digital Signal Processing Supplant the Need for Acoustic Treatment?
It’s tempting to think that the latest digital signal processing (DSP) features integrated into microphones can compensate for less-than-ideal room acoustics. However, my experience suggests otherwise. While DSP can effectively reduce background noise, control proximity effects, and enhance certain frequencies, it cannot replace the foundational importance of acoustic treatment. Properly treated spaces—using bass traps, diffusers, and absorption panels—create a neutral environment that allows even modest microphones to perform at their best.
